数据库管属于什么软件
-
数据库管理系统(DBMS)属于一种软件。它是用于管理和组织数据的软件工具。DBMS允许用户创建、访问、更新和管理数据库中的数据。它提供了一种结构化的方法来存储和检索数据,并允许用户执行各种操作,如查询、排序、过滤和统计。
以下是关于数据库管理系统的一些重要特点和功能:
-
数据存储和组织:DBMS负责在物理存储介质上创建和组织数据。它可以将数据以表格、文件或其他适合的方式存储在磁盘上,以便于有效的管理和访问。
-
数据安全性和完整性:DBMS提供了安全性和完整性控制机制,以确保只有授权的用户可以访问和修改数据。它可以通过用户身份验证、访问权限控制和数据加密等方式来保护数据的机密性和完整性。
-
数据一致性和并发控制:DBMS可以处理多个用户同时访问和修改数据的情况,以确保数据的一致性。它使用并发控制技术,如锁定和事务处理,来管理并发访问并保持数据的一致性。
-
数据查询和操作:DBMS提供了强大的查询语言和操作功能,使用户能够轻松地执行复杂的数据查询和操作。常用的查询语言包括结构化查询语言(SQL)和NoSQL数据库的查询语言。
-
数据备份和恢复:DBMS允许用户创建数据备份,以便在发生数据丢失或灾难性故障时能够恢复数据。它提供了备份和恢复工具和技术,如数据库备份和日志文件恢复。
总之,数据库管理系统是一种用于管理和组织数据的软件工具,它提供了数据存储、安全性控制、数据一致性和并发控制、数据查询和操作以及数据备份和恢复等功能。它是现代应用程序和信息系统中不可或缺的一部分。
1年前 -
-
数据库管理系统(Database Management System,简称DBMS)是一种软件,用于管理和组织数据库。它提供了一种结构化的方式来存储、管理和操作数据,使得用户可以方便地访问和使用数据库中的数据。
数据库管理系统的主要功能包括数据定义语言(Data Definition Language,简称DDL)、数据操作语言(Data Manipulation Language,简称DML)、数据查询语言(Data Query Language,简称DQL)和数据控制语言(Data Control Language,简称DCL)等。
DDL用于定义数据库的结构和组织方式,包括创建和删除数据库、表、视图、索引等。DML用于插入、更新和删除数据库中的数据。DQL用于查询数据库中的数据,常用的查询语句包括SELECT、FROM、WHERE等。DCL用于控制数据库的访问权限和安全性,包括GRANT和REVOKE等。
数据库管理系统还提供了事务管理、数据完整性、并发控制、故障恢复等功能。事务管理用于保证数据库操作的原子性、一致性、隔离性和持久性,即ACID特性。数据完整性用于保证数据库中的数据符合预设的约束条件,如唯一性约束、外键约束等。并发控制用于处理多个用户同时对数据库进行操作的情况,以防止数据冲突和不一致性。故障恢复用于在数据库发生故障时恢复数据的一致性和可用性。
常见的数据库管理系统有Oracle、MySQL、SQL Server、PostgreSQL等,它们都是由不同的软件公司或组织开发和维护的。每种数据库管理系统都有其特定的特性和适用场景,用户可以根据自己的需求选择合适的数据库管理系统来管理和操作数据库。
1年前 -
数据库管理软件是用于管理和操作数据库的软件工具。它提供了一系列的功能和工具,用于创建、修改、查询和管理数据库中的数据。数据库管理软件通常包括数据库服务器和客户端工具两个部分。
数据库服务器是一个运行在服务器上的软件,负责管理和维护数据库。它提供了一个存储数据的地方,并且可以处理来自客户端的请求。数据库服务器通常具有高性能、高可靠性和高安全性的特点。常见的数据库服务器软件包括MySQL、Oracle、SQL Server等。
客户端工具是用于与数据库服务器进行交互的软件。它提供了一个用户界面,使用户可以通过图形界面或命令行界面来操作数据库。客户端工具可以执行各种操作,如创建表、插入数据、更新数据、删除数据、查询数据等。常见的数据库客户端工具有Navicat、SQL Developer、SQL Server Management Studio等。
数据库管理软件的主要功能包括以下几个方面:
-
数据库的创建和维护:数据库管理软件可以帮助用户创建数据库,并提供了一些工具来维护数据库的结构和属性。用户可以创建表、定义字段、设置索引、设定约束等。
-
数据的导入和导出:数据库管理软件可以将数据从其他数据源导入到数据库中,也可以将数据库中的数据导出到其他数据源中。这样可以方便地将数据从一个数据库迁移到另一个数据库,或者与其他软件进行数据交互。
-
数据的查询和分析:数据库管理软件提供了强大的查询功能,用户可以使用SQL语言来编写查询语句,从数据库中提取所需的数据。同时,数据库管理软件也提供了一些数据分析功能,如排序、过滤、聚合等,帮助用户更好地理解和分析数据。
-
数据库的备份和恢复:数据库管理软件可以帮助用户定期备份数据库,以防止数据丢失。同时,当数据库发生故障时,也可以使用数据库管理软件进行数据的恢复操作。
-
安全管理:数据库管理软件提供了一些安全管理工具,用于设置用户权限和访问控制。用户可以根据需要创建用户账号,并为不同的用户分配不同的权限,以保证数据库的安全性。
综上所述,数据库管理软件是用于管理和操作数据库的软件工具,它包括数据库服务器和客户端工具两个部分,具有创建和维护数据库、数据导入导出、数据查询分析、数据库备份恢复和安全管理等功能。常见的数据库管理软件有MySQL、Oracle、SQL Server等。
1年前 -